What is the average price of a house in Turners Hill?
The average price for a house in Turners Hill is £566k, costing on average £452 per sqft.
Average prices of houses by bedroom count are: £363k for a two-bedroom, £440k for a three-bedroom, £642k for a four-bedroom, and £959k for a five-bedroom.
What share of houses in Turners Hill feature gardens and parking?
In Turners Hill, 98% of houses have a garden and 96% include parking.
What is the breakdown of property types in Turners Hill?
The housing mix in Turners Hill is 41% detached, 31% semi-detached, 23% terraced, and 6% other.

What is the average price of a flat in Turners Hill?
The average price for a flat in Turners Hill is £221k, costing on average £497 per sqft.
Average prices of flats by bedroom count are: £175k for a one-bedroom, £239k for a two-bedroom, N/A for a three-bedroom, and N/A for a four-bedroom.
What share of flats in Turners Hill feature balconies and parking?
In Turners Hill, 46% of flats have a balcony and 94% include parking.
What is the breakdown of lease types in Turners Hill?
The leasing mix in Turners Hill is 100% leasehold and 0% freehold.
